轻松搭建个人VPN服务器全攻略

南风 3 0
本指南从零开始,详细介绍了如何轻松搭建自己的VPN服务器。涵盖服务器选择、配置、安全设置及连接方法等关键步骤,助你轻松实现数据加密与远程访问。
  1. 挑选VPN协议
  2. 选定服务器硬件与操作系统
  3. 安装与配置服务器
  4. 客户端连接步骤
  5. 测试与性能优化

轻松搭建个人VPN服务器全攻略,如何建立vpn服务器,第1张

随着互联网的广泛应用,VPN(虚拟私人网络)已经成为守护个人隐私和数据安全的关键工具,无论是身处公共Wi-Fi环境中,还是需要远程访问公司内部资源,VPN都能为我们构筑一道坚固的安全防线,如何搭建属于自己的VPN服务器呢?下面,我们将逐步引导您完成这一过程,轻松构建您的个人VPN服务器。

挑选VPN协议

在着手搭建VPN服务器之前,首先需熟悉不同VPN协议的特点及其适用场景,目前市面上常见的VPN协议包括PPTP、L2TP/IPsec、OpenVPN和IKEv2等。

1. PPTP:配置简便,连接速度较快,但安全性相对较低,易遭受攻击。

2. L2TP/IPsec:安全性较高,但配置过程相对复杂。

3. OpenVPN:安全性优异,配置灵活,支持多种加密算法,是目前颇受欢迎的VPN协议之一。

4. IKEv2:安全性高,支持自动连接与断开,非常适合移动设备使用。

根据您的具体需求,选择最合适的VPN协议。

选定服务器硬件与操作系统

1. 服务器硬件:选择一台性能强劲的服务器,以下硬件配置是基本要求:

- CPU:Intel Core i5或AMD Ryzen 5及以上型号

- 内存:8GB或以上

- 存储:固态硬盘(SSD),容量至少500GB

- 网卡:千兆网卡

2. 操作系统:选择一个稳定、安全的操作系统,如Ubuntu、CentOS、Debian等。

安装与配置服务器

1. 安装操作系统:将操作系统部署到服务器上,并配置好网络参数。

2. 安装VPN服务器软件:

- 对于OpenVPN,可以使用以下命令进行安装:

```bash

sudo apt-get update

sudo apt-get install openvpn

```

- 对于L2TP/IPsec,可以使用以下命令进行安装:

```bash

sudo apt-get update

sudo apt-get install strongswan

```

3. 配置VPN服务器:

- 对于OpenVPN,需要创建一个名为server.conf的配置文件,并设定相关参数,例如服务器地址、端口、加密算法等。

- 对于L2TP/IPsec,需要配置strongswancharon的配置文件,设定VPN参数。

客户端连接步骤

1. 下载并安装VPN客户端软件:根据所选的VPN协议,下载相应的客户端软件。

2. 配置客户端:

- 输入VPN服务器的IP地址和端口。

- 输入用户名和密码(如需)。

- 根据需求选择加密算法和压缩算法。

3. 连接VPN:启动VPN客户端,输入用户名和密码,连接至VPN服务器。

测试与性能优化

1. 测试VPN连接:连接VPN后,检查网络连接是否正常,确保可以访问互联网。

2. 优化VPN性能:根据实际需求,调整VPN服务器的配置参数,例如增加内存、调整加密算法等。

遵循以上步骤,您将能够成功搭建个人VPN服务器,但需注意,搭建VPN服务器需要一定的技术知识,并且在搭建过程中必须遵守相关法律法规,在享受VPN带来的便利的同时,确保您的行为合法合规。

标签: #如何建立vpn服务器

  • 评论列表

留言评论

请先 登录 再评论,若不是会员请先 注册
请先 登录 再评论,若不是会员请先 注册